Br\u00fcno<\/a> <\/strong>(Universal): After the success of Borat, Sacha Baron Cohen<\/a> returns with another mock-documentary comedy, this time playing the flamboyant Austrian fashionista Br\u00fcno, who wreaks havoc at a fashion show and then travels to America, where the fun continues.<\/p>\n

Directed by Larry Charles<\/a>, stand out sequences involve Bruno debating the Middle East conflict with orthodox Jews and Palestinian terrorists; an uncomfortable appearance on a TV chat show with an adopted African child; an extended attempt to \u2018become straight\u2019 with the help of religion, martial arts and the US military; and a truly riotous climax involving a cage wrestling match in Arkansas.
